    Intellian’s Enterprise Flat Panels Go Live on OneWeb LEO Network

    Sam AllcockBy Sam Allcock12/03/2025

    Expanding Next-Generation Connectivity for Land, Maritime, and Mobility Applications

    Intellian Technologies Inc., a leading provider of advanced satellite user terminals, has announced the availability of its new Enterprise Flat Panel series on Eutelsat’s OneWeb Low Earth Orbit (LEO) network. This latest release marks a significant milestone in delivering enterprise-grade connectivity solutions, enabling high-speed, reliable communication across diverse operational environments.

    Innovative Technology for Seamless Global Connectivity

    The Enterprise Flat Panel series includes three key models:

    • OW11FL (Land Fixed) – Designed for static locations requiring high-performance, uninterrupted connectivity.
    • OW11FV (Land Mobility) – Ideal for moving vehicles, ensuring consistent network access on the go.
    • OW11FM (Maritime) – Engineered for vessels, providing stable and robust connectivity at sea.

    Each flat panel features Intellian’s state-of-the-art antenna technology, ensuring uninterrupted communication even in the most challenging conditions. By integrating advanced tracking capabilities, these terminals deliver maximum throughput available on OneWeb’s LEO network, catering to a wide range of industries, including enterprise, maritime, and government sectors.

    Cutting-Edge Design with Resilient Performance

    With an ultra-sleek form factor, the Enterprise Flat Panels pack powerful technology into a compact and lightweight structure. They offer enhanced performance over wide scan angles and low elevation positions, ensuring seamless connectivity even in remote locations.

    Additionally, the optional Resilient Global Navigation Satellite System (R-GNSS) support enhances positioning accuracy, offering greater operational reliability in critical environments.

    Building on the Success of Compact Flat Panels

    The launch of Enterprise Flat Panels follows the success of Intellian’s Compact Flat Panels, which debuted in late 2024 through Eutelsat’s network.     Strengthening the Eutelsat-OneWeb Partnership

    The launch of the Enterprise Flat Panels further deepens the partnership between Intellian and Eutelsat, enhancing OneWeb’s user terminal portfolio for global distribution partners. These advanced terminals are specifically designed to offer customers flexibility, adaptability, and superior connectivity, making them ideal for fixed, mobile, and maritime applications.
